Foundation underpinning services involve strengthening and stabilizing existing building foundations to address issues such as settling, cracking, or uneven floors. These projects typically cover homes experiencing structural movement, especially in areas prone to soil shifting or moisture changes. Property owners considering underpinning often want to understand the scope of work required, the methods used to reinforce the foundation, and how the process may impact their property. It is also common to seek information about the signs indicating foundation problems and the potential long-term benefits of addressing them.

Before requesting underpinning services, homeowners usually want to know about the different techniques available, such as piering or underpinning piers, and how these methods can restore stability. Clarifying the extent of foundation movement, the condition of the existing structure, and any necessary preparations can help property owners make informed decisions. Understanding the purpose of underpinning-preventing further damage and ensuring the safety of the building-can also guide homeowners in determining whether this service is suitable for their property.

Common Foundation Underpinning Jobs

Foundation Underpinning - stabilizes and strengthens existing foundations to prevent settling or shifting.

Pier and Beam Support - raises and reinforces homes built on pier and beam foundations.

Concrete Lifting - raises sunken or uneven concrete slabs to restore level surfaces.

Structural Repair - addresses cracks, bowing, or other damage to maintain foundation integrity.

Soil Stabilization - improves soil conditions around the foundation to reduce future movement.

Basement Support - reinforces basement walls to prevent bowing and water intrusion.

Foundation Underpinning Questions

What is foundation underpinning? Foundation underpinning involves strengthening or stabilizing an existing foundation to address issues like settling or cracks.

When is underpinning necessary? Underpinning may be needed if a property shows signs of foundation movement, uneven floors, or wall cracks.

What methods are used for underpinning? Common methods include installing additional support piers or underpinning piles to reinforce the foundation.

How does underpinning benefit a property? Underpinning helps prevent further damage, improves stability, and can extend the lifespan of a building’s foundation.
